I removed the bracket #40 and I have it on the bench.

I have a hard time removing the c clip # 31 so I can replace the bushing. It is located in a channel and I have a hard time gripping it in any way to get it out.

Any technique or special tool that I should employ?

After scratching my head and under the assumption that these were smart engineers I got the answer…

No tool required.
The c clip does not has to come out; just push the bushing and the clip gives in by entering into the groove. With sufficient push force the bushing just comes out…
